The town of Bad Schussenried has set itself ambitious climate protection targets. The focus is on increasing energy efficiency, as well as the development of renewable energy sources. In this context, energy management is becoming increasingly important. To make further progress in this area, Bad Schussenried has joined the "European Energy Award®" (eea®) programme together with other towns and municipalities from Baden-Württemberg.
The eea® process involves the appraisal and the cataloging potential future energy-saving and climate protection measures in the following fields of activity:
- Communal development planning and regional planning
- Communal buildings and installations
- Supply and disposal
- Mobility
- Internal organisation
- External communication and co-operation
In the appraisal process, the involvement of the town of Bad Schussenried in the various fields of activity is analysed on the basis of the list of measures and evaluated according to a points scheme. To this end, it is necessary to commission an eea® advisor to conduct a performance review (internal audit) and to further adapt the energy Policy Programme to the new actual situation.
